Torsion Spring Replacement
Torsion springs are the most critical and dangerous component in any garage door system. In Rutherford, they fail faster than almost anywhere else in Bergen County. The persistent Meadowlands humidity—especially in low-lying areas near the eastern edge of town—accelerates oxidation on the spring wire. Where a dry western Bergen town might see 10–12 years from a quality spring, Rutherford’s timeline often compresses to 5–7 years. We’ve replaced torsion springs on homes near Lincoln Avenue and along Route 3 where the springs had visibly rusted through after just six years of service.
A typical torsion spring replacement in Rutherford runs $180–$340. That includes the spring itself, winding cones, and professional installation. Do not attempt to wind or unwind a torsion spring yourself—these components store lethal tension and require specialized tools and training. Joseph Taylor handles this work personally, matching the spring’s wire gauge, inside diameter, and length to your door’s exact weight and lift requirements.
Extension Spring Systems
Extension springs run parallel to the horizontal tracks and are more common on Rutherford’s lighter single-car garage doors—particularly the original 8-foot-wide units in the borough’s older neighborhoods. These springs stretch and contract with each door cycle, and the non-standard door weights in Rutherford’s historic garages demand precise calibration. Too strong, and the door shoots up; too weak, and it won’t stay open. We measure, source, and install extension spring sets that match your specific door geometry, not a generic chart.
Cables & Drums
Cable failures in Rutherford follow a distinct pattern. The narrow 8-foot-wide openings common in pre-war garages create sharper offset angles at the drums than modern 9-foot or 16-foot standards. Cables fray faster here, and drum wear accelerates because the cable wraps tighter with each cycle. We’ve replaced cable-and-drum assemblies on homes near Park Avenue where the original hardware had ground itself smooth after decades of operation.
A cables and drums replacement in Rutherford typically costs $130–$250. We use galvanized or stainless cable where appropriate for humid conditions, and we inspect the drum’s grooves for scoring that would destroy a new cable in months. Rollers & Hinges
Steel rollers seize. Nylon rollers crack. Hinges elongate at the bolt holes until the door panels rack and bind. On Rutherford’s older doors—especially the carriage-house styles with decorative hardware—these seemingly small parts determine whether your door glides quietly or shakes the whole frame. We stock both standard and specialty rollers, including low-noise nylon options for homes where the garage sits beneath a bedroom.
Rollers and hinges replacement in Rutherford runs $110–$220 for a typical single-car door. Joseph Taylor inspects every hinge and roller during service; replacing one failed roller while leaving five others on borrowed time doesn’t match how we work.
Bottom Seal & Weatherstripping
Rutherford’s damp climate is brutal on bottom seals. The constant moisture exposure—worse near the Meadowlands fringe—causes rubber and vinyl seals to harden, crack, and lose contact with the floor within 2–3 years. Once the gap opens, you’re inviting drafts, water intrusion, and rodents. We’ve replaced bottom seals on detached garages throughout the 07070 ZIP where the original seal had literally crumbled to fragments.
Bottom seal replacement in Rutherford costs $50–$120 depending on width and seal type. For the most persistent moisture problems, we recommend bulb-style or dual-fin seals that maintain contact even on slightly uneven concrete. Common Garage Door Parts Problems We See in Rutherford Homes
- Torsion springs corroding prematurely from Meadowlands humidity. The elevated ambient moisture in Rutherford’s low-lying areas accelerates rust on spring wire, leading to sudden snaps well before the 10-year mark typical in drier climates. We see this most often on detached garages east of Park Avenue.
- Bottom seals degraded by constant damp exposure. Rubber seals harden and crack faster here than in western Bergen County. The gap that develops lets in water during heavy rains and provides entry points for rodents seeking shelter.
- Cables fraying at drums on narrow 8-foot openings. The tighter wrap angle on Rutherford’s non-standard widths creates accelerated wear where cable meets drum. This failure mode is rare in newer suburbs with standard 9-foot or 16-foot doors.
- Seized rollers and binding hinges on 1920s carriage-house doors. Original steel rollers rust solid in humid conditions, and the decorative hardware on period doors often conceals wear until the door starts scraping or jamming.
